Ship: Grand Princess, Leaving Greenock. She had a one day stop over, arrived early morning and sailed 19.00 hours. At this time of year this type of ship cruises around Europe. One day in each port.
She can be seen here, off the berth. pointing up the River Clyde, she slowly turns around and heads to the open sea.
